2011-05-07 76 views
3

在Winforms中,有一個叫做「消息泵」的概念。是否有解釋所有這些,以及爲什麼這很重要?消息抽取?

謝謝

回答

3

我建議你從這裏開始: http://msdn.microsoft.com/en-us/library/ff381409%28v=VS.85%29.aspx

解釋如何的Windows如何工作的,並且是直接從微軟的基本知識。

我會建議遵循該特定MSDN教程中提供的鏈接的層次結構(請按照每頁上內容底部的「Next」鏈接)。

此鏈接可能是一個更直接的回答你的問題: http://msdn.microsoft.com/en-us/library/ff381405%28v=VS.85%29.aspx

如果你真的想了解的Windows的內部工作,我會建議獲得這本書的副本:

Windows程序設計用C++ - ISBN-10:0201758814

0

您試過wikipedia

Microsoft Windows程序是基於事件的。他們根據操作系統發佈到應用程序主線程的消息採取行動。應用程序通過在稱爲「事件循環」的一段代碼中重複調用GetMessage(或PeekMessage)函數從消息隊列接收這些消息。